Weekend Afternoon Dates for Comfort-First Dating: Low-Pressure Invites in Feesburg, Ohio

For dating in Feesburg, Ohio, a weekend afternoon date can be more useful when a low-pressure invitation supports comfort-first dating. The practical question is simple: how to suggest a date without making it feel too intense. Comfort is not boring; it is what lets two people pay attention to each other.

  1. Shape the plan: Choose a daytime plan with enough flexibility for conversation, a simple activity, or an easy exit.
  2. Protect comfort: Use one clear suggestion, a practical time window, and a tone that leaves space for the other person to say yes, no, or another day.
  3. Use the chat well: Ask what helps them feel at ease when meeting someone new.
  4. Know what to avoid: Avoid dramatic wording, expensive plans, or anything that makes a first meeting feel like a test.

If the connection is still casual, keep the tone light while staying honest about pace and expectations. A date in Feesburg, Ohio does not need to answer everything at once. It only needs to help two people notice whether comfort, curiosity, and communication are moving in the same direction.

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Get Replies

Feeling unsure what to say is normal—use that energy to be clear, curious, and low-pressure. Start with short, adaptable patterns you can tweak to fit a profile instead of copying lines or handing someone a generic compliment.

  • Profile hook + question: Spot a detail (a book, pet, travel photo) and ask a specific, easy question. Example: “I love that photo at the coast—what was the best part of that trip?”
  • Two-choice prompt: Give a light, fun choice to lower the bar for replying. Example: “Morning coffee or evening tea—what powers your day?”
  • Curiosity callback: Refer to something small they mentioned and expand it into a quick, personal question. Example: “You mentioned salsa dancing—how did you get into it?”
  • Casual shared-interest opener: Name a mutual interest from their profile and add a one-sentence opinion to invite a response. Example: “You’re into indie films—I’m always hunting for a great recommendation. Seen anything good lately?”
  • Playful micro-challenge: Use a light, friendly dare to spark banter. Example: “Two truths and a lie—surprise me with yours.”

Keep messages brief (one to three lines), use their name or a detail when possible, and avoid backhanded or overly intense compliments. Don’t lead with soul-searching questions or lines that could be interpreted as canned—those make conversations stall. Instead, aim for specificity and an easy next step (a question, a choice, or a tiny challenge).

Quick edits to make openers yours

  1. Swap in a real detail from their profile instead of a generic noun.
  2. Tone down formality—write like you would to a friendly neighbor.
  3. If you’re nervous, add a self-effacing line: “I’m terrible at intros, but…”—it humanizes you.

Finally, if a first message doesn’t get a reply, that’s okay—move on with a short follow-up after a few days only if you have something new to add.
